Cysticercus cellulosae is Zoonoses caused by Cysticercus cellulosae which is larva of Taenia solium.The harm degree of Cysticercus cellulosae varies according to part and amount. Cerebral cysticercosis is of great harm.The effective diagnosis of Cysticercus cellulosae is key to control it.But as a Platyhelminthes parasite,antigenic component of Cysticercus cellulosae is very complex.Cross-reactivity with other helminth infections occurs in wholewormantigen and affects specificity of detection. Cysticercus antigen includes. C.Cyst fluid antigen ,C.Scolex antigen and C.Baldder wall antigen.These antigens vary with different developmental stage . Moreover ,excretary-secretary antigen was excreted during the development of cysticercus in host body . Even so,recent year with the development of molecular hiology,recombinant antigens has become hotspot of immunodiagnosis of cysticercosis because of favorable detection effect. Compared with C.Scolex and C.Baldder , cyst fluid of Cysticercus cellulosae is full of lipoprotein and glycoprotein .PH value of antigenic component is mainly located in basicity region .In recent years,immunologic studies shows that a specific IgG4 level was elevated when the body was stimulated by a complex antigen includingsome parasites.After the recovery from the infection ,this specific IgG4 level fell rapidly or disappeared.This suggests the specific IgG4 level reflected the infectious condition of the patients. Forein scholars have found that in some parasitie infections,specific IgG increases in all four subclasses antibody but especially in IgG4, Over 50% of the total reactive antibody was IgG4,and this was found in almost all patients. In this paper,C.Cyst fluid antigen was used to conduct dimensional electrophoresis and immunoblotting. It is found that alkaline protein bind tightly to gG4 antibody, primarily small molecular weight proein .In the study,51 antigen spots was screened by antigen.24 positive antigen spots were found by mass spectrographic analysis.These spots were related with 12 kinds of protein of cysticercus.Every positive spot has 4 to 5 related protein . Secreted antigen Ts8B3( 16/24 ), Secreted antigen Ts8B2 ( 18/24 ), Sequence 3 from patent US 6589752(15/24)和Cysticercosis 10kDa antigen(16/24)were the most related protein. The ES antigen gene Ts8B2 was cloned from Cysticercus cellulosae by RT-PCR and sequenced. The cDNA fragment without signal peptide was subcloned intoPET30α-GST vector and expressed in E.coli BL-21.SDS-PAGE showed that the expressed fusion protein was approximately 33ku.High purity recombinant protein was obtained by GST affinity chromatography. This study laid foundation for further study of the recombinant protein as antigen for antibody detection of Cysticercus cellulosae.
